    Good post by "Kent Boy 2" on the Sunderland forum:

    One of the few things that I really bite on is Stokes.

    Anyone that is "underwhelmed" by his performances last season needs to give their heads a shake if you ask me.

    As I've said to those people before - go back and watch the videos of his games and watch his overall game rather than concentrating on the fact that he shoots from silly places too often.

    Watch how many times he controls the ball first time. Watch the runs he makes into acres of space but doesn't get the ball. Watch how many times he is telling the seasoned pros (including the likes of Whitehead & Connolly) where to pass the ball. Watch how he is always making himself available in space. Watch how little time he is standing still. And watch the ease with which he plays the game.

    And all this from an 18 year old that was played out of position for most of his games.

    The things he does wrong like not taking shots from silly places and keeping hold of the ball too long will come right with experience and good coaching.

    The things that he does right like his control, movement and understanding of the game, come naturally.

    Anthony Stokes

    Republic of Ireland under-21 coach Don Givens was fuming last night after Sunderland striker Anthony Stokes failed to report for duty. The 19-year-old Dubliner was due to play in a prestige friendly against Germany in Fürth Upon ringing the player, Givens discovered that Stokes had withdrawn through an unspecified injury and the manager is livid with both the player and the club for the situation.
    "I rang Anthony on his mobile to ask him where he was and he said: 'I'm in Dublin, did the boss not get in touch with you?'" explained the Irish under-21 chief.
    "I told Anthony than I'd heard nothing and he said: 'Well, I picked up a knock on Saturday and the boss told me twice that he'd sort it."
    "My reaction was that it was also his responsibility to phone me. I'm very disappointed to find myself in that position," said Givens.
    "As soon as the squad was announced Blackburn were on to me to tell me that Keith Tracey was injured and offered to send me the results of his scan. That shows how thorough they are.
    "I'm very disappointed to find another Premier League club not behaving in a similar fashion."
